About Tekever
Tekever is the European leader in AI-driven Unmanned Aerial Systems (UAS), delivering autonomous platforms — including the AR3, AR3 EVO and AR5 — to defence, security and government customers across the UK, Europe and allied nations. Our systems have logged over 10,000 operational flight hours in Ukraine and form the aerial platform for the Royal Air Force’s StormShroud programme.
Through our five-year, £400m OVERMATCH investment programme, Tekever is building the UK’s largest drone production capability — including a new 254,000 sq ft facility in Swindon — and creating more than 1,000 highly skilled British jobs. We are a vertically integrated business spanning aerospace structures, propulsion, optical and RF payloads, avionics, communications, software and AI.
The Role
The Logistics Operator is a hands-on, shop-floor role at our West Wales Airport site. You keep parts and materials moving through the site — receiving and inspecting goods inwards, storing and picking stock, kitting and feeding the assembly and integration cells, supporting the teams that test and service our aircraft, and packing and dispatching finished aircraft and spares.
You make sure the right parts are in the right place, at the right time, in the right condition and with the right paperwork — and that what the system says we hold matches what is physically on the shelf. You work closely with Supply Chain, Production Planning & Control, Quality, the assembly and integration cells, and the flight-test and servicing teams, and you are part of building the logistics operation up from the ground as the site scales through the OVERMATCH programme.
